Oil leak top of engine left side 2 Attachment(s) Took my failing starter off to find oil had been leaking directly onto it. This looks like the source of the leak. I'm gonna replace the valve cover because that's my best idea. Please help. |
Re: Oil leak top of engine left side I would clean around the black plug..... then check it later. It looks as if there is oil around the bottom area of that plug. |
Re: Oil leak top of engine left side Agree with CraigW, that plug is a very common leak area, buy a new one and reseal it |
Re: Oil leak top of engine left side When you replace it, look for an aluminum plug those will last longer than a replacement exactly the same. I replaced one of these on my wife's crv and it began to leak a few months after. The plastic plug broke down and was leaking from a crack right thru the middle of it. This time I looked for an aluminum plug online and replaced it with that, its been leak free ever since :tup::cool: |
Re: Oil leak top of engine left side The plastic plug broke down and was leaking from a crack right thru the middle of it. The rubber O ring will usually last 100k or so like the rest of the rubber seals. |
Re: Oil leak top of engine left side The plastic plug was brittle and broke easily when i was inspecting it, so I chose a metal plug with o rings to be done with it |
